Transaction f94d370c79718685276f065e05411a575bf178890180f5f63a93fc0ca190bbd2

1 Input
2 Outputs
  • f94d370c79718685276f065e05411a575bf178890180f5f63a93fc0ca190bbd2:0
  • value  2651448
    address  3H5C8xuMgrtADWxHLLivLMf8aq5hr8tLao
  • f94d370c79718685276f065e05411a575bf178890180f5f63a93fc0ca190bbd2:1
  • value  3257563082
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V